Bottled. Lots of yeast residue. A little barnyard, full body. Some sourness. Gooseberries, yeast. Nice complexity.

Bottled. Cloudy golden color, short head. Aroma of some hop, bit honey, some spicy wheat. Bit yeasty taste, quite spicy. More in the style of Wallonian and French white beers, so bit more spicy and not as much citrussy notes as Flemish white beers.
